Preparing Floors for Modern Renovation Projects

Surface preparation is an essential part of any flooring renovation. After old materials are removed, the underlying surface must be inspected for cracks, uneven areas, or adhesive residue. This step ensures that the new flooring will be installed on a stable and smooth base. Renovation experts often repair minor damages and level the floor before the installation of new materials begins. Proper preparation prevents future problems such as shifting tiles, loose flooring panels, or uneven surfaces. By focusing on careful preparation, professionals help ensure that new flooring remains durable and visually appealing for many years.

Challenges Involved in Removing Adhesive Residue

One of the most common issues encountered after old flooring removal is leftover adhesive on the subfloor. Adhesives used in flooring installations are designed to be strong and long-lasting, which makes them difficult to remove without professional tools. Adhesive residue can create uneven surfaces that interfere with the proper installation of new flooring materials. If adhesive remains on the surface, it may cause tiles or boards to sit unevenly, leading to long-term structural issues. Professional flooring specialists address this challenge by using advanced equipment and effective techniques to remove adhesive layers completely and prepare the floor for its next stage of renovation.
